Incident at SW Phila. elementary school under investigation

SOUTHWEST PHILADELPHIA - January 23, 2014

The incident was reported Thursday by a family member of a student at the Morton Elementary School, located in the 6300 block of Elmwood Avenue in Southwest Philadelphia.

The family of a 6-year-old girl at Morton Elementary reported the incident Thursday.

They say the school has a policy of older students escorting younger ones to the bathroom, and that's when the attack happened.

"What she was doing was beating her with a belt, put her head in the toilet, and was trying to bully her into doing whatever she wanted her to do. This is weird, it's embarrassing and it is just not right," said Michele Finney, grandmother.

The school district says they are working with the Philadelphia Police Department to conduct a full investigation into the incident.
